aboutsummaryrefslogtreecommitdiffstats
path: root/src/gallium/drivers/r600/r600_pipe.h
Commit message (Expand)AuthorAgeFilesLines
* r600: Update state code to accept NIR shadersGert Wollny2020-02-101-1/+4
* gallium: switch boolean -> bool at the interface definitionsIlia Mirkin2019-07-221-12/+12
* r600/eg: rework atomic counter emission with flushesDave Airlie2018-08-211-6/+8
* gallium: add storage_sample_count parameter into is_format_supportedMarek Olšák2018-07-311-0/+2
* r600g: some -Wsign-compare fixesKonstantin Kharlamov2018-07-171-1/+1
* amd,radeonsi: rename radeon_winsys_cs -> radeon_cmdbufMarek Olšák2018-06-191-8/+8
* r600g: Implement scratch buffer state management (v2)Glenn Kennard2018-02-091-1/+15
* r600: work out target mask at framebuffer bind.Dave Airlie2018-02-071-0/+1
* r600: work out shader export mask at shader build time (v1.1)Dave Airlie2018-02-071-0/+1
* r600: add ARB_query_buffer_object supportDave Airlie2018-01-291-0/+1
* r600/eg: construct proper rat mask for image/buffers.Dave Airlie2018-01-291-2/+5
* r600: increase number of UBOs to 15Roland Scheidegger2018-01-101-4/+9
* r600: increase number of ubos by one to 14Roland Scheidegger2018-01-101-4/+6
* r600: always flush between gfx and computeDave Airlie2017-12-181-0/+1
* r600: add support for compute grid/block sizes. (v2)Dave Airlie2017-12-061-0/+3
* r600: handle image/buffer sizes correctly.Dave Airlie2017-12-061-0/+2
* r600: refactor and export some shader selector code for computeDave Airlie2017-12-051-0/+10
* r600: add compute support to compressed resource handling.Dave Airlie2017-12-051-0/+1
* r600/cs: add support for compute to image/buffers/atomics stateDave Airlie2017-12-051-1/+5
* r600: add ARB_shader_storage_buffer_object support (v3)Dave Airlie2017-12-011-1/+3
* r600: add cull distance supportDave Airlie2017-11-211-0/+2
* r600: add core pieces of image support.Dave Airlie2017-11-171-1/+44
* r600: add gs tri strip adjacency fix.Dave Airlie2017-11-141-0/+1
* r600: add support for hw atomic counters. (v3)Dave Airlie2017-11-101-0/+22
* r600: fork and import gallium/radeonMarek Olšák2017-09-261-2/+2
* gallium/radeon: make S_FIXED function signed and move it to shared codeMarek Olšák2017-07-261-4/+0
* r600/eg: add support for tracing IBs after a hang.Dave Airlie2017-06-011-0/+11
* gallium: remove pipe_index_buffer and set_index_bufferMarek Olšák2017-05-101-3/+0
* r600g: update dirty_level_mask after the 1-st draw after FB changeConstantine Kharlamov2017-04-191-0/+1
* Revert "r600g: get rid of dummy pixel shader"Marek Olšák2017-04-121-0/+3
* r600g: get rid of dummy pixel shaderConstantine Kharlamov2017-04-101-3/+0
* r600g: add draw_vbo check for a NULL pixel shaderConstantine Kharlamov2017-04-101-0/+1
* r600g: extract a code into a r600_emit_rasterizer_prim_state()Constantine Kharlamov2017-04-041-3/+5
* r600g/radeonsi: use the correct types (taken from pipe_draw_info)Constantine Kharlamov2017-04-041-4/+4
* radeonsi/gfx9: fix MIP0_WIDTH & MIP0_HEIGHT for compressed texture blitsMarek Olšák2017-03-301-4/+0
* r600g: make framebuffer atom rely on dual src blend state.Dave Airlie2017-03-151-0/+1
* gallium/radeon: move r600_common_context::texture_buffers to r600gMarek Olšák2016-10-041-0/+5
* gallium/radeon: set VPORT_ZMIN/MAX registers correctlyMarek Olšák2016-09-051-0/+1
* gallium/radeon: add can_sample_z/s flags for texturesNicolai Hähnle2016-07-061-8/+0
* r600g: Implement POLYGON_OFFSET_UNITS_UNSCALEDAxel Davy2016-06-251-0/+2
* r600g: only do necessary cache flushes in cp_dma_clear_bufferMarek Olšák2016-06-041-0/+17
* r600g: fix CP DMA hazard with index buffer fetches (v3)Marek Olšák2016-06-041-1/+4
* radeon/winsys: introduce radeon_winsys_cs_chunkNicolai Hähnle2016-06-011-5/+5
* gallium/radeon: use radeon_emitNicolai Hähnle2016-05-171-2/+2
* gallium/radeon: clean left-shift undefined behaviorNicolai Hähnle2016-05-071-3/+3
* r600g/radeonsi: send endian info to format translation functionsOded Gabbay2016-04-261-3/+5
* r600: fix missing include for Elements macroDave Airlie2016-04-261-0/+1
* r600g: Move R600_BIG_ENDIAN to r600_pipe_common.hOded Gabbay2016-04-181-6/+0
* r600g: use common scissor and viewport codeMarek Olšák2016-04-121-17/+0
* radeonsi: move scissor and viewport states into gallium/radeonMarek Olšák2016-04-121-2/+0